The National Monuments Service's description
On a S-facing slope in pasture. Excavated in 2006-7 in advance of the N9/N10 Kilcullen to Waterford Road Improvement Scheme. Excavation licence no. 2517, AR053-4 Area A-F. A range of kilns (19 in all) forming one element of a cluster of monuments found in close proximity to each other in an area c. 1.8ha with dates ranging from the Late Neolithic to the early medieval period. The kilns which were present all across the excavated area produced large quantities of cereal remains, indicating that they are likely to have been used in the drying of cereals, perhaps prior to storage or as part of crop-processing activities to separate grains from chaff. Different types of kiln structures appear to have been in use from the Iron Age to the Early Medieval period including keyhole-shaped, figure of eight and T-shaped examples. Although some kiln types appear to have been constructed during both the Iron Age and Early Medieval period, differences can be detected in the types of cereals being processed. (Channing 2009, 255-6, no. 1003; 2010a, 234, no. 881; 2010b)
